### TileForge Cache Layer — Quick Start

Welcome, future maintainer! The Bramblewood tile-rendering cache (TileForge) keeps pre-baked map tiles warm so the renderer isn't hammered on every zoom. Evictions run hourly; don't change the TTL without pinging the maps channel. To poke the cache admin endpoint locally, use the key below.

API key for yahig-tadup: kto7_ubizbYm

### TICKET-creation: Vault locked — markdown pipeline config (Inkmill)

For the weekly sync: the Inkmill markdown rendering pipeline can't fetch its sanitizer config because the secrets vault auto-locked after the node restart. Rendering falls back to plaintext meanwhile. Unlocking requires manual recovery on the primary vault node using the passphrase below.

unlock words, yawig-kagef: gordor-holvan-ulaael-pramir-ulaiel-tamdor

To the release manager: I'm passing ownership of the Pellwick deep-link router to Sorrel before the 4.2 cut. The intent-matching table now lives in the Farrowgate config service; stale entries were purged last sprint. Watch the fallback route — it silently swallows malformed slugs, which inflated our drop-off metrics in March. The staging resolver needs its keystore unlocked before each regression pass, and that keystore accepts only one credential. For the signing vault, the recovery phrase is noted directly below.

recovery phrase for tafog-fafog: novix-novdor-fraath-brieth-olieth-oliix-rusix-wenion-julax-druox

The exporter converts to the tenant's configured zone at
# render time only — never at write time. If a tenant has no zone set,
# we fall back to the org default, not the server locale; this caused
# the Fernway incident last quarter. Daylight-saving boundaries are
# handled by the zone library, so do not hand-roll offsets. The exporter
# reads tenant zone settings from the config database using this
# connection string.

replica DSN, kajep-yahag: mssql://praok_svc:iF@db-8d68.plorvaio.local:5432/eliion